Just finished up. If it were nicer in the Northwest, I'd get better pictures. Here's a list of the works since it's always nice to know what folks are riding on. There really isn't as much of a rake as it looks in the picture.

'72 Disk Brake transplant with McGaughys drop spindles,
2500 & 2600 airlift bags
5 gal air lift tank
VU-4 Manifold with 3/8" lines
Single Viair 444 Compressor
CPP C-Notch with 1.5" blocks
7 Switch Controler
15X7s with 215-70-15 Firestones set on the fender wells the same time the crossmember sits on the deck.

Tell me how on earth do you drive these trucks when they are so low to the ground ?
I can only vision hitting every high spot in the rd .

Quote:
Originally Posted by mygmctruck View Post
Tell me how on earth do you drive these trucks when they are so low to the ground ?
I can only vision hitting every high spot in the rd .
They have air suspension that is fully adjustable to accommodate different road conditions.
